Associations Between SSRI Exposure During Pregnancy and MRI-Assessed Brain Structure and Connectivity in Infants

JAMA Pediatrics Author Interviews: Covering research, science, & clinical practice in the health and well-being of infants, children, and adolescents by American Medical Association

Apr 9, 201805:45Health

This audio summary reviews a cohort study exploring the association between prenatal exposure to sel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ors and gray matter volume and white matter structural connectivity in newborn infants.
